Date: Sun, 13 Dec 2020 00:34:35 +0000 From: Graham Perrin <grahamperrin@gmail.com> To: Hans Petter Selasky <hps@selasky.org> Cc: FreeBSD questions <freebsd-questions@freebsd.org> Subject: =?UTF-8?B?dmlydHVhbF9vc3MsIGN1c2UsIHdlYmNhbWQg4oCm?= Message-ID: <bab05206-f76f-1a64-2719-2089252ba381@gmail.com> In-Reply-To: <8a030de2-86ef-c3f5-5f50-929f7a842892@selasky.org> References: <96ce7276-6ec1-c87c-ca08-4a24b671a5d7@gmail.com> <3da4613d-fdf7-6fbe-baae-1f998724e31f@gmail.com> <729b7d39-659f-1fde-b34f-bc882ec45bc9@selasky.org> <11b501b5-95a5-cada-174f-94950e57a192@gmail.com> <8a030de2-86ef-c3f5-5f50-929f7a842892@selasky.org>
next in thread | previous in thread | raw e-mail | index | archive | help
On 12/12/2020 19:46, Hans Petter Selasky wrote: > On 12/12/20 6:40 PM, Graham Perrin wrote: >> … > > Right. > > Maybe some application didn't close down. Then you can't unload > virtual_oss. > > procstat -akk | grep cuse > > may give you some clues. > > --HPS Thanks grahamperrin@mowa219-gjp4-8570p:~ % sudo service virtual_oss status grahamperrin's password: virtual_oss is running as pid 14585. grahamperrin@mowa219-gjp4-8570p:~ % sudo service virtual_oss stop Stopping Virtual OSS config dsp ... done grahamperrin@mowa219-gjp4-8570p:~ % procstat -akk | grep cuse grahamperrin@mowa219-gjp4-8570p:~ % sudo service virtual_oss status virtual_oss is not running. grahamperrin@mowa219-gjp4-8570p:~ % time sudo virtual_oss -C 2 -c 2 -r 48000 -b 24 -s 8.0ms -f /dev/dsp3 -d dsp hw.snd.basename_clone: 0 -> 0 load: 4.47 cmd: virtual_oss 38000 [cuse-server-cv] 113.63r 0.33u 0.45s 0% 4964k mi_switch+0xc1 sleepq_catch_signals+0x82 sleepq_wait_sig+0x9 _cv_wait_sig+0xe4 cuse_server_ioctl+0x9db devfs_ioctl+0xc7 vn_ioctl+0x1a1 devfs_ioctl_f+0x1e kern_ioctl+0x26d sys_ioctl+0xf6 amd64_syscall+0x10c fast_syscall_common+0xf8 ^C0.345u 0.496s 2:00.44 0.6% 120+375k 0+0io 0pf+0w grahamperrin@mowa219-gjp4-8570p:~ % sudo procstat -akk | grep cuse 1157 100586 webcamd - mi_switch+0xc1 sleepq_catch_signals+0x82 sleepq_wait_sig+0x9 _cv_wait_sig+0xe4 cuse_server_ioctl+0x9db devfs_ioctl+0xc7 vn_ioctl+0x1a1 devfs_ioctl_f+0x1e kern_ioctl+0x26d sys_ioctl+0xf6 amd64_syscall+0x10c fast_syscall_common+0xf8 1157 100700 webcamd - mi_switch+0xc1 sleepq_catch_signals+0x82 sleepq_wait_sig+0x9 _cv_wait_sig+0xe4 cuse_server_ioctl+0x9db devfs_ioctl+0xc7 vn_ioctl+0x1a1 devfs_ioctl_f+0x1e kern_ioctl+0x26d sys_ioctl+0xf6 amd64_syscall+0x10c fast_syscall_common+0xf8 1157 100701 webcamd - mi_switch+0xc1 sleepq_catch_signals+0x82 sleepq_wait_sig+0x9 _cv_wait_sig+0xe4 cuse_server_ioctl+0x9db devfs_ioctl+0xc7 vn_ioctl+0x1a1 devfs_ioctl_f+0x1e kern_ioctl+0x26d sys_ioctl+0xf6 amd64_syscall+0x10c fast_syscall_common+0xf8 1157 100702 webcamd - mi_switch+0xc1 sleepq_catch_signals+0x82 sleepq_wait_sig+0x9 _cv_wait_sig+0xe4 cuse_server_ioctl+0x9db devfs_ioctl+0xc7 vn_ioctl+0x1a1 devfs_ioctl_f+0x1e kern_ioctl+0x26d sys_ioctl+0xf6 amd64_syscall+0x10c fast_syscall_common+0xf8 1157 100703 webcamd - mi_switch+0xc1 sleepq_catch_signals+0x82 sleepq_wait_sig+0x9 _cv_wait_sig+0xe4 cuse_server_ioctl+0x9db devfs_ioctl+0xc7 vn_ioctl+0x1a1 devfs_ioctl_f+0x1e kern_ioctl+0x26d sys_ioctl+0xf6 amd64_syscall+0x10c fast_syscall_common+0xf8 1157 100704 webcamd - mi_switch+0xc1 sleepq_catch_signals+0x82 sleepq_wait_sig+0x9 _cv_wait_sig+0xe4 cuse_server_ioctl+0x9db devfs_ioctl+0xc7 vn_ioctl+0x1a1 devfs_ioctl_f+0x1e kern_ioctl+0x26d sys_ioctl+0xf6 amd64_syscall+0x10c fast_syscall_common+0xf8 1157 100705 webcamd - mi_switch+0xc1 sleepq_catch_signals+0x82 sleepq_wait_sig+0x9 _cv_wait_sig+0xe4 cuse_server_ioctl+0x9db devfs_ioctl+0xc7 vn_ioctl+0x1a1 devfs_ioctl_f+0x1e kern_ioctl+0x26d sys_ioctl+0xf6 amd64_syscall+0x10c fast_syscall_common+0xf8 1157 100706 webcamd - mi_switch+0xc1 sleepq_catch_signals+0x82 sleepq_wait_sig+0x9 _cv_wait_sig+0xe4 cuse_server_ioctl+0x9db devfs_ioctl+0xc7 vn_ioctl+0x1a1 devfs_ioctl_f+0x1e kern_ioctl+0x26d sys_ioctl+0xf6 amd64_syscall+0x10c fast_syscall_common+0xf8 1157 100707 webcamd - mi_switch+0xc1 sleepq_catch_signals+0x82 sleepq_wait_sig+0x9 _cv_wait_sig+0xe4 cuse_server_ioctl+0x9db devfs_ioctl+0xc7 vn_ioctl+0x1a1 devfs_ioctl_f+0x1e kern_ioctl+0x26d sys_ioctl+0xf6 amd64_syscall+0x10c fast_syscall_common+0xf8 grahamperrin@mowa219-gjp4-8570p:~ % grep -A 1 webcamd /etc/rc.conf webcamd_enable="YES" # <https://www.freshports.org/net-im/zoom/> webcamd_flags="-H" grahamperrin@mowa219-gjp4-8570p:~ % ---- Later: ---- grahamperrin@mowa219-gjp4-8570p:~ % sudo service virtual_oss stop && sudo service webcamd stop && sudo virtual_oss -C 2 -c 2 -r 48000 -b 24 -s 8.0ms -f /dev/dsp3 -d dsp && sudo service webcamd start webcamd is not running. grahamperrin@mowa219-gjp4-8570p:~ % cat /dev/sndstat Installed devices: pcm0: <ATI R6xx (HDMI)> (play) pcm1: <IDT 92HD81B1X (Analog 2.0+HP/2.0)> (play/rec) default pcm2: <IDT 92HD81B1X (Analog)> (play/rec) pcm3: <USB audio> (play/rec) No devices installed from userspace. grahamperrin@mowa219-gjp4-8570p:~ % sudo service webcamd status webcamd is not running. grahamperrin@mowa219-gjp4-8570p:~ % sudo service virtual_oss stop ; sudo service webcamd stop ; sudo virtual_oss -C 2 -c 2 -r 48000 -b 24 -s 8.0ms -f /dev/dsp3 -d dsp && sudo service webcamd start webcamd is not running. hw.snd.basename_clone: 0 -> 0 load: 6.15 cmd: virtual_oss 54255 [cuse-server-cv] 34.84r 0.16u 0.08s 0% 4404k mi_switch+0xc1 sleepq_catch_signals+0x82 sleepq_wait_sig+0x9 _cv_wait_sig+0xe4 cuse_server_ioctl+0x9db devfs_ioctl+0xc7 vn_ioctl+0x1a1 devfs_ioctl_f+0x1e kern_ioctl+0x26d sys_ioctl+0xf6 amd64_syscall+0x10c fast_syscall_common+0xf8 ^C grahamperrin@mowa219-gjp4-8570p:~ % sudo procstat -akk | grep cuse grahamperrin@mowa219-gjp4-8570p:~ %
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?bab05206-f76f-1a64-2719-2089252ba381>